Output 343f84abb926e5ae561ec9aa3854120129f3ab9318593a00dcbf18eedf028790:0

value
15863520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42692e5b5bdeabe6fbf87616ac697730231be786 OP_EQUAL
address
MDxJqCbGoqXSe8JL6DxbdpAe9eDzXwrUPy
transaction
343f84abb926e5ae561ec9aa3854120129f3ab9318593a00dcbf18eedf028790
spent
true